Indie selects for generalists with taste.

True in film, games, art, etc.

If you're doing any of those industries as part of a machine, you learn just how to turn that crank as part of a larger machine you likely don't understand at all.

But if you're doing indie, you have to have an approximate sense of all of the aspects of creating it.

Much richer knowhow.

To be successful in an indie context you must have taste.
